Frank W. Duffy, 80, of Hayward, died Sunday, January 11, 2015 at Water's Edge Care Center.
Frank William Duffy was born on July 29, 1934 in Hayward, the son of William and Frances Duffy. He was raised in Hayward and went to the Hayward Community Schools and graduated in 1952. He was employed by the Peoples National Bank and was Sawyer County Clerk. Frank was a member of the Hayward National Guard and served at Fort Lewis during the Berlin Crisis. He was a director of Hayward Chamber of Commerce in 1967, belonged to the Knights of Columbus and the Hayward Lions Club. Frank enjoyed bowling, golfing, fishing and traveling.
